Challenging a golfer's view on strength & fitness

The key to quicker changes in your golf game
is building and maintaining a higher level
of cardio and muscular fitness. Golf-specific strength and fitness training is available
in private sessions, group fitness, pilates
and yoga at the home of Zone Golf:


The Highland Park Hospital
Health and Fitness Center


Including fitness components in golf programs will promote improved balance, posture, flexibility, strength, endurance and most importantly confidence.

Participants will experience the opportunity to lose weight, build muscle mass, regain muscle tone or lost agility and vigor once enjoyed as a child.
